如何进行服务器带宽监控和性能优化?
服务器带宽监控和性能优化是确保服务器高效、稳定运行的关键步骤。以下是一些建议的方法和策略:
选择如Nagios、Zabbix、PRTG等专业的网络监控工具来实时监控服务器的带宽使用情况。这些工具可以提供实时的带宽图表、警报和报告。
在服务器上配置简单网络管理协议(SNMP),以便与监控工具集成,并提供有关网络接口的详细信息。
定期检查带宽使用报告,识别任何异常流量模式或瓶颈。
使用性能分析工具(如top
、htop
、iostat
、vmstat
等Linux命令或Windows的性能监视器)来识别服务器上的瓶颈,如CPU、内存、磁盘I/O或网络。
使用负载均衡器将流量分散到多个服务器上,以提高整体性能和可用性。
实施页面缓存、对象缓存等策略,减少对后端服务器的请求。考虑使用内容分发网络(CDN)来缓存静态内容并加速内容交付。
定期清理无用的日志文件、临时文件和不再需要的软件包。保持服务器操作系统的更新和打补丁。
确保服务器上运行的所有软件都是最新的,并配置了必要的安全措施,如防火墙、入侵检测系统等。
在监控工具中设置合适的警报阈值,以便在带宽使用过高或性能下降时及时收到通知。
定期审查监控数据和报告,确保服务器始终运行在最佳状态。
通过结合这些策略和方法,可以有效地监控服务器的带宽使用情况并进行性能优化,确保服务器能够高效、稳定地处理各种工作负载。